Eric Barnard
Chief Executive Officer · Risk AdvisorEric is a former federal law enforcement executive and U.S. diplomat with more than 25 years of experience in investigations, intelligence, international operations and risk management. His leadership assignments included DEA Country Attaché in Paraguay, Assistant Country Attaché in Ecuador, and Resident Agent in Charge in the Caribbean.
He has led complex investigations and specialized vetted units targeting transnational organized crime, money laundering, threat finance and narcotics trafficking. He has served in liaison assignments with U.S. intelligence agencies and trained foreign counterparts in tactics, investigations, intelligence, operational planning and risk assessment.
Fluent in Spanish, Eric brings extensive experience working alongside law enforcement, intelligence, military, diplomatic and private-sector partners throughout the United States and Latin America.

Ric M. Bachour
PrincipalRic is a former senior federal law enforcement executive with more than 27 years of law enforcement service and 23 years of military service. His career includes senior DEA leadership, international diplomatic assignments, covert operations, counter-narcoterrorism, money laundering, threat finance and transnational organized crime investigations.
As a DEA Country Attaché, Ric oversaw operations across Europe and West Africa and helped establish the first U.S.–France International Joint Investigative Team targeting Hezbollah’s European money-laundering network. He has led major international investigations and worked extensively throughout Europe, Africa, Latin America, the Caribbean and the Middle East.
A retired U.S. Marine Corps Chief Warrant Officer, Ric is fluent in Arabic and French, with working knowledge of Spanish.

Christine A. Hanley
Principal · Executive Protection SpecialistChristine is a former senior federal law enforcement professional with more than 26 years of experience in executive protection, complex investigations, intelligence, counterterrorism, anti-money laundering and international operations.
Her career includes service with the U.S. Secret Service and DEA, including presidential advance security assignments, the DEA Executive Protection Detail, and diplomatic assignments as Assistant and Acting Country Attaché in Belgium.
She later served in DEA’s Special Operations Division supporting sensitive operations throughout Europe and Africa. Today she specializes in discreet, intelligence-driven executive protection, protective intelligence, threat assessment and risk mitigation for high-profile individuals, corporate leaders and organizations.

Miguel Angel Godinez Munoz
Violent Crime & Transnational Crime SpecialistMiguel is a senior law enforcement and criminal justice professional with extensive experience combating violent crime, organized crime, money laundering, human trafficking and international fugitives.
As the first Attorney General of the State of Guerrero, Mexico, he led security strategies credited with significant reductions in homicides and kidnappings in Acapulco. Previously, as an INTERPOL International Agent, Miguel coordinated extraditions and operations targeting high-priority fugitives.
He also served as a Federal Organized Crime Prosecutor specializing in money laundering, and has worked internationally with the United Nations and UNODC on transnational organized crime, human trafficking, security policy and anti-impunity initiatives. Miguel holds a Doctorate in Criminal Policy and is the author of El Orgullo de Ser Policía.
